What is Pay By The Load

Getting paid by the load means you won't be quoted pay per mile. You will be given a certain amount to do the load depending on where you're going. Most of these types of situations that I've seen has been local or regional runs.


You could see this in oilfield jobs, containers or other specialties.

Find out if the pay is for round trip coming back empty or if you need to pick up another load.

What you have to figure out is how long it will take total. Then see if the pay you end up with justifies the amount of time it will take.

Then will you do the same thing each day or will the loads vary.
Best question will likely be how much can you expect to make each month.
